发明名称 | 配置逻辑器件阵列的方法和系统 | ||
摘要 | 一种部分重新配置门阵列的系统和方法,通过逻辑电路的放置和路径(312)产生一个设计数据库(314),访问该数据库以修改由放置和选路所创建的逻辑单元配置(322)。根据修改情况,创建仅包含实现修改逻辑单元的位流的部分配置位流(324)。将部分配置位流下载到门阵列(326),由此执行门阵列的部分重新配置。在另一个实施例中,根据本发明的系统包括软件实用程序(604),它允许应用程序(602)在包含可编程门阵列的系统中执行,在运行过程中对门阵列进行重新配置。实用程序包括根据在运行时间期间检测到的外部条件而修改设计的程序。这种方法避免了需要提供一组预定备用设计,而允许应用程序自身作出决定。 | ||
申请公布号 | CN1121016C | 申请公布日期 | 2003.09.10 |
申请号 | CN97199308.4 | 申请日期 | 1997.10.15 |
申请人 | 爱特梅尔股份有限公司 | 发明人 | M·T·梅森;S·C·埃文斯;S·S·阿拉耐克 |
分类号 | G06F17/50 | 主分类号 | G06F17/50 |
代理机构 | 上海专利商标事务所 | 代理人 | 李玲 |
主权项 | 1.一种配置可编程逻辑单元阵列的方法,其特征在于:所述阵列包括多个可编程互连关系,每个所述逻辑单元在所述阵列中具有一个唯一单元位置,所述阵列具有一种相关的逻辑设计,所述方法包括:访问一个设计数据库,该数据库代表逻辑单元定义和对应于所述逻辑设计的逻辑单元互连关系的一种配置;把所述设计数据库的一部分提供给用户;输入用户指定的变化,对所述设计数据库的用户所选部分进行重新定义;产生一部分配置位流,仅描述与所述设计数据库的所述重新定义部分相关的所述逻辑单元和所述的互连关系;以及将所述部分配置位流下载到所述逻辑单元阵列中,由此仅配置所述逻辑单元阵列中对应于所述用户指定变化的这些部分。 | ||
地址 | 美国加利福尼亚州 |